Criminal Justice Fellows, 2002-2003
Annie-Laurie Blair
Assistant Editor
The Cincinnati Enquirer
Annie Laurie-Blair is the assistant metro editor/criminal justice at The Cincinnati Enquirer. She supervises reporters who cover crime and public safety, local and federal court systems, FBI/ATF/DEA, immigration issues, homeland security, the gambling industry and science/environment, as well as the Enquirer's investigative reporter. Her team won the 2001 Freedom of Information Award from Gannett Co. Inc., plus top Ohio, Kentucky and Gannett awards for coverage of Cincinnati's 2001 riots, Cincinnati Police, the proliferation of Oxycontin, and CAR analyses of street violence and prosecution of drug dealers. Blair, a St. Louis native and U.S. Army veteran, graduated from the University of Missouri School of Journalism and earned a master's degree in journalism from Boston University. She also has worked at daily newspapers in Kansas City, Boston, Ithaca, N.Y., and Elmira, N.Y.
